1、首先確保一些核心參數配置正確router
修改 /etc/sysctl.conf的以下參數:server
net.ipv4.ip_forward=1ip
net.ipv4.ip_nonlocal_bind = 1
net.ipv4.conf.lo.arp_ignore = 1
net.ipv4.conf.lo.arp_announce = 2
net.ipv4.conf.all.arp_ignore = 1
net.ipv4.conf.all.arp_announce = 2it
sysctl -p /etc/sysctl.confio
cat /proc/sys/net/ipv4/ip_forwardast
cat /proc/sys/net/ipv4/ip_nonlocal_bindemail
cat /proc/sys/net/ipv4/conf/lo/arp_ignore
cat /proc/sys/net/ipv4/conf/lo/arp_announce
cat /proc/sys/net/ipv4/conf/all/arp_ignore
cat /proc/sys/net/ipv4/conf/all/arp_announce配置
2、在主節點 修改keepalived.confroute
global_defs {
notification_email{
andy_hugb@hotmail.com
}
notification_email_from andy_hugb@163.com
smtp_server mail.163.com
smtp_connect_timeout 30
router_id LVS_DEVEL
}keepalived
vrrp_instance VI_1 {
state MASTER
interface ens33
virtual_router_id 51
priority 100
advert_int 1
mcast_src_ip 192.168.222.132
authentication {
auth_type PASS
auth_pass 8888
}
virtual_ipaddress {
192.168.222.134/24 brd 192.168.222.255 dev ens33 label ens33:vip
}
}
3、在備節點修改keepalived.conf
global_defs {
notification_email{
andy_hugb@hotmail.com
}
notification_email_from andy_hugb@163.com
smtp_server mail.163.com
smtp_connect_timeout 30
router_id LVS_DEVEL
}
vrrp_instance VI_1 { state BACKUP interface ens33 virtual_router_id 51 priority 100 advert_int 1 mcast_src_ip 192.168.222.133 authentication { auth_type PASS auth_pass 8888 } virtual_ipaddress { 192.168.222.134/24 brd 192.168.222.255 dev ens33 label ens33:vip }}